8. Aggregating Financial Risk
Challenge
• Demonstrate to the regulators the aggregation and detail of
the company’s counterparty exposure within 24 hours of a
request.
Solution
• It was determined through a cost / benefit analysis and
review of the company’s maturity level, that they would not
be able to respond quickly to the required ad- hoc reporting
without creating a “fire drill” and risking incorrect data.
Therefore a permanent daily solution was implemented that
would be able to meet future ad-hoc requests.
•
Impact
• The team pulled together company-wide detailed trade information across 7 Lines of Business, covering
20+ products from 50+ systems of record for daily processing.
Data was not being consistently calculated or reported so common definitions needed to be established.
Completeness, filter and field definitions were unique for this request, creating a new view of the data.
200+ people across the company implemented this solution separate from the main portfolio of projects
in 4 phases over 4 months while working hand-in-hand with audit.
The solution was later integrated into the mainstream regulatory reporting.
Issues impacting other regulatory requirements were identified as a byproduct of this effort and
remediated.

9. Managing Mainframe Entitlements
Challenge
The existing environment had overly complex entitlements that were based upon severe technical limitations
and arcane definitions that were meaningless to both business and technical staff. There was significant over-
entitlement and poor quality of data and processes associated with mandatory entitlement reviews.
Additionally, lack of a risk based approach in the management of entitlements had resulted in single points of
failure.
Solution
Entitlement management program implemented:
• Targeted changes to the technical
environment to overcome limitations
Clear definition of roles and entitlements of
those roles
Simplification of those roles, profiles and IDs
so people managers understand entitlements
Process enhancements to systematically
update, add and remove entitlements
•
•
•
Impact
• Created a simpler risk based approach to handling
security handled across complex legacy environments.
• Eliminated the single point of failure

10. Implementing Data Governance
Challenge
• There was inconsistent regulatory and financial data being delivered across the company with questionable
sourcing and quality. This data was being used for high profile regulatory and financial reporting.
Solution
• The data governance structure was put in place with
accountability at all levels of the organization.
Put in place policy that requires metadata to be
established and key data elements to be consistently
defined across systems.
Identify approved provisioning points and technology
feeds that need to comply with provisioning architecture.
Established standards (e.g., data quality) and measured
businesses using variance from the standard in a
dashboard.
Created a central governing organization with line of
business liaisons that ensured ongoing support.
•
•
•
•
Impact
• Data management policy implemented across the fortune
500 financial institution.
Guidelines enabled more effective merger / acquisitions.•
